These both warms and cools via two types of fabric! An eye pillow with 2 functions. No need to use the microwave or put in the refrigerator - this ecological eye pillow is also kind to your wallet.
The slightly fragrant Japanese cypress chips will put you in a relaxing mood. This comes in a decorative box, so it makes the perfect present. In a black color.
●Care for your eyes the same day!
When your eyes are tired from looking at a smartphone, PC or TV, you shouldn't leave your tired eyes uncared for.
If your eyes are tired, it is important to care for them the same day. Accumulated tiredness also effects the shoulders, waist and head. And just because you are young doesn't mean this won't effect you.
●Relax the muscles around the eyes
An easy way to refresh yourself, which is introduced in books etc, is to alternately place hot and cold towels over your eyes to soothe the muscles there.
However, should you actually try this, there are unexpected hassles such as making your bedding wet with water etc. Therefore, this reversible type eye pillow that allows you to experience coolness and warmth without using a microwave or fridge, is currently gaining popularity.
●Reversible
The warm side has micro-fleece with ultra-fine fibers and a ceramic charcoal sheet for heat insulation, keeping in warmth to convey a warm sensation.
The cool side is made using new natural fibers that use eucalyptus wood. When it touches the skin, it allows you to experience a natural cool sensation.
A must-have item for your down time that relieves daily tiredness at the eyes.
[kinokoto]
A lifestyle brand that proposes items that offer both functionality and sensibility. Cherishing both "wood" and "feeling" while taking the environment into account.
Their aim is to propose a lifestyle that helps both Japanese forests and the lives of people. The original concept behind "Kinokoto" is to take advantage of the functionality of natural materials while preserving Japanese forests and valuing the balance, the "feeling", between people and nature.
Over a period of 15 years, using thinned wood as a raw material, they have been creating items that are kind to people and the environment. Centered mainly around ceramic charcoal produced in-house, their items use natural materials such as wood, silk, organic cotton and leather.
All items are made in Japan, valuing the sensibilities of Japanese people and the feeling of craftsmanship

Katagami Metal Hand Mirror, Tortoiseshell & Cherry Blossom, Silver
A Rin crossing certified item.
[7th TASK Monozukuri Grand Prize/Incentive Award Winner in 2012]
[Katsushika brand "Katsushika-cho Kojo Monogatari" certified in 2013]
Made using a traditional patterned stencil, a tool for dyeing kimono patterns. This new tableware series was born from a collaboration between Yada Stencil Shop, that has been continued making patterns in Katsushika Ward since the Edo period, and the traditional metal products of Asakawa Metal Works. These are items that are sure to bring new richness into your life.
This product is a cast metal hand mirror (zinc die cast) with a pattern of a stencil used for dyeing kimono etched into the plate. The fusion of traditional and modern techniques bring about new added value.
It is currently being sold at long-established department stores and famous online shopping sites. In silver plated and black plated colors, and available in 7 designs. This is a tortoiseshell & cherry blossom pattern silver plated item.
